Offline Lesson: Setting Career Goals. Teachers will login to EVERFI through the district portal, find the Keys To Your Future Resources, select Lesson Plans, and Setting Career Goals. • Day 1: Opening for the lesson and New Learning • Day 2: Finish Day 1 then move to the Activity • Day 3: Students finish BLS Research Handout and Closing. Career competencies. In 2021, the National Association of Colleges and Employers (NACE) identified eight new key career competencies for career readiness. Wayne State University Career Services advises that students understand, develop, enhance, and learn to articulate these competencies to transition into the workplace successfully.

Students learn how their long-term career goals connect to shorter-term decisions and goals related to post-secondary education. This lesson explores different post-secondary options available, as well as returns on investment. It identifies methods to help learners make strong, educated choices, and how networking can impact the process. Module.
